How to Use This Calculator
  1. Enter the total Loan Amount you need to borrow.
  2. Set the Federal Interest Rate (e.g., 5.5% for current direct loans) and the Private Interest Rate you have been quoted.
  3. Choose Loan Term (Years) — 10 years is the standard federal plan; private lenders may offer 5–20 years.
  4. Set Grace Period (Months) — federal loans typically offer a 6-month grace period after graduation.
  5. Review Federal vs. Private Monthly Payment and Total Interest side by side to identify the Cheaper Option.
  6. Use Monthly Savings and Total Savings to quantify the long-term benefit of the lower-rate loan.
